Technically guests have to cancel ADRs the day before to avoid paying the no show fee (e.g., so cancel on Monday for a Tuesday ADR).
In terms of making ADRs, yes, you can make same day ADRs. They just modified the system so you can make ADRs for within an hour of the current time. I did that recently at Epcot. I made a reservation for Les Chefs for dinner about an hour later (made ADR at 7:30 pm for an 8:30 pm ADR). There were times closer, but we wanted to have enough time to walk through Epcot without feeling rushed.
Whether or not an ADR for the specific restaurant you want and/or at the time you want will come available will vary by restaurant, time, time of the year, etc. If there is a specific place you want and/or a specific time, I would keep checking for ADRs from now until the day of the meal. You never know when someone will cancel an ADR.
